Concentrated feed for pregnant sow

The invention provides a concentrated feed for a pregnant sow, which mainly comprises the following raw materials by weight percentage: 58 portions of soybean meal (46%), 10 portions of rapeseed meal, 10 portions of beer yeast powder, 9 portions of corn gluten feed, 3.75 portions of calcium hydrogen phosphate, 4.00 portions of stone powder, 1.70 portions of common salt, 0.5 portions of choline, 2.5 portions of core material specially used for pregnant sow, 0.50 portions of saleratus, 0.40 portions of montmorillonite and 0.05 portions of propionate mould inhibitor. The method comprises the following steps: selecting the raw materials by proportion, magnetically selecting the components, crushing the components, weighing the components by an electronic steelyard, automatically compounding, mixing and stirring the components, detecting the quality, separating, weighing and packaging the components respectively, thus obtaining the product. When in use, the concentrated feed for the pregnant sow is mixed with the self-prepared coarse material containing rice bran, green fodder and the like to feed the pregnant sow, wherein the proportion between the concentrated feed and the coarse material is 2:8; therefore, the full nutrition of the pregnant sow and the piglet can be satisfied, the farrowing rate of the sow and the livability of the piglet are improved, and about 12 or 13 pigletscan be borne by each sow according to the feeding experience and no dead piglet exists basically.

Intelligent sow feeding system and controlling method

The invention discloses an intelligent sow feeding system and a controlling method. The system comprises a controller, a feeding pipe, a storehouse connected with the controller, a discharging unit and a touching sensor, wherein the storehouse is connected with the feeding pipe; the controller comprises a mainboard controlling module, a controlling panel and a blanking motor; the mainboard controlling module is connected with the touching sensor, the controlling panel and the blanking motor respectively; input signals are received by the touching sensor and transmitted to the mainboard controlling module to control the blanking of the blanking motor; the system reduces the opportunities of people contacting with fodder, so that germ infection is further reduced. The invention further discloses the controlling method of the system. According to the invention, the mainboard controlling module judges whether key values exist, so that feeding mode can be selected and feeding parameters are set; the remaining capacity of auto-updated sow feeding in one day is read by the controller from the mainboard controlling module, and the mainboard controlling module starts or closes a triggering switch according to the triggering signals of the counters of the touching sensor and the mainboard controlling module, so that feeding restriction is realized, and the use of electronic ear tags is avoided.

Chinese herbal medicine additive for improving fertility of sow and method for preparing Chinese herbal medicine additive

The invention discloses a Chinese herbal medicine additive for improving the fertility of sow. The Chinese herbal medicine additive comprises, by weight, 2-10 parts of herba leonuri, 2-10 parts of eucommia ulmoides, 2-10 parts of herba epimedii and 1-5 parts of Himalayan teasel roots. The invention further discloses a method for preparing the Chinese herbal medicine additive. The Chinese herbal medicine additive and the method have the advantages that the Chinese herbal medicine additive is scientific in combination and has obvious effects of preventing diseases and protecting health of the sow, improving the production performance of animals, improving the quality of animal products and the quality of fodder and the like; the effects of preventing the diseases and protecting the health of the sow are mainly represented in the aspects of enhancing the immunity of the sow, inhibiting bacteria, expelling parasites, regulating functions of the sow and the like; the effect of improving the production performance of the sow is mainly represented in the aspects of promoting the growth of the sow, promoting the development of the reproductive organs of the sow, increasing a pregnancy rate and a farrowing rate and reducing a piglet mortality rate; the effect of improving the quality of fodder is mainly represented in that the Chinese herbal medicine additive has effects of supplementing nutrition, enhancing aroma and deodorizing, preventing mildew and rotting and the like, accordingly, the nutrition of the fodder is improved, the appetite of the sow is promoted, the shelf life of the fodder is prolonged, and the like.

Carnivorous fur-bearing animal feed and preparation method thereof

The invention provides a carnivorous fur-bearing animal feed and a preparation method thereof. The feed includes vegetable raw materials, vitamins, trace elements, mineral matters and functional additives. The feed is characterized by comprising, by weight: 65-175 parts of vegetable raw materials, 0.02-1.5 parts of vitamins, 0.15-3.2 parts of trace elements and mineral matters, and 0.5-6.5 parts of functional additives. With comprehensive and balanced nutrition, good feed attraction and palatability, the carnivorous fur-bearing animal feed of the invention can be mixed with animal raw materials into a pasting feed preferred by carnivorous fur-bearing animals. The feed can promote the healthy growth of carnivorous fur-bearing animals. After taking the feed product, the carnivorous fur-bearing animals in a growing period grow significantly, with healthy state and less illness; and the carnivorous fur-bearing animals in a reproduction period can have an increased farrowing rate and high cubs survival rate; in a furring period, the carnivorous fur-bearing animals have shining furs and substantial needly down. With good viscosity, the feed, after blended with animal raw materials, doesnot scatter. Thus being used as a pasting feed, the feed of the invention cannot fall out of a cage, so that the feed waste is reduced.

Bamboo rat ecological breeding method

The invention discloses a bamboo rat ecological breeding method comprising the following steps: (1) bamboo rats are placed into breeding tanks of an imitation ecological breeding unit, wherein the breeding unit comprises at least two breeding tanks arranged on the left and the right; a certain space is left between the two breeding tanks, such that a first planting tank is formed; each of the breeding tanks is enclosed by a bottom plate, side enclosure plates and a cover plate; cement prefabricated parts provided with holes are placed in the tanks, such that each breeding tank is divided into a rest zone and a living zone; one side of the cement prefabricated part is close to a right side enclosure plate, and the other side has a certain distance from a left side enclosure plate; drainage grooves are arranged on the bottom plates; second planting tanks enclosed by separation plates are arranged on the top of the cover plates, wherein the living zones are partially or completely exposed; the bottom plates, the cover plates and the separation plates are prepared with cement plates or stone plates; soil is laid in the first and second planting tanks; (2) the bamboo rats are fed at dusk every day; and (3) crops are planted in the first and second planting tanks and are used as a bamboo rat feed; and bamboo rat manure is directly added into the planting tanks and is used as a fertilizer.

Application of decidua NK cells and decidua NK cell exosomes from cell subsets in preparing drugs and auxiliary therapeutic agents for treating diseases related to infertility

The invention provides application of decidua NK cells and decidua NK cell exosomes from cell subsets in preparing drugs and auxiliary therapeutic agents for treating diseases related to infertility.Experiments prove that the exosomes treat endometrium growth disorders by promoting endometrial thickness increasing, improving endometrial cell activity, reducing endometrial cell damage, promoting VEGF expression, maintaining stem features of endometrium matrix cells and stimulating proliferation, so that the pregnancy success rate of endometrium damage model mice is increased to 50-70% from 20%; and the exosomes treat diseases related to maternal-fetal immunologic tolerance disorders by playing a role of immunologic tolerance, reducing a spontaneous abortion rate and improving a help T lymphocyte level. Besides, the exosomes can effectively increase the developmental rate of zygotes fertilized no matter in vitro or in vivo in a multiple mode, meanwhile, an in-vitro fertilization rate, an implantation rate of implantation and a birth rate are also increased, and positive assisting effects on infertility treatment are achieved.

Establishment method of human rotavirus induced pathological damage and diarrhoea suckling mouse animal models

The invention provides an establishment method of human rotavirus induced pathological damage and diarrhoea suckling mouse animal models. The establishment method comprises following steps: SPF grade4 to 5 days old NIH sucking mice with weight ranging from 3.5g to 5.0 are randomly selected as experimental animals; animal waste is collected, and colloidal gold method is adopted for rotavirus antigen detection; 10 of the sucking mice with negative results are selected so as to obtain a model group, each of the 10 sucking mice is fed with 0.2ml of human rotavirus centrifugation harvested fluid through the oral cavities; 10 of the sucking mice with negative results are selected so as to obtain a reference group, each of the 10 sucking mice is fed with 0.2ml of Vero cell freeze thawing centrifugation supernate through the oral cavities; 8h later, rotavirus antigen in the animal waste of the model group is detected, if obtained results are positive, establishment of the rotavirus infected sucking mouse experimental model is realized; gold labeled method is adopted to detect rotavirus antigen in the animal waste of the reference group, and the results are negative. The advantages of theestablishment method are that: simulation of rotavirus infected acute gastroenteritis characteristics of infants and children such as diarrhoea can be realized, and rapid establishment of rotavirus infected sucking mouse experimental models can be realized.

The invention relates to an integrated high-efficiency low-cost breeding method of sows and piglets. The integrated high-efficiency low-cost breeding method specifically comprises the following steps: feeding the sows with first fodder from mating pregnancy to the 89th day of gestation of the sows; feeding the sows with the first fodder from the 90th day of gestation to delivery, and feeding the sows with second fodder from the delivery to ablactation of the piglets; feeding the piglets with third fodder from the 10th day of lactation of the piglets to the 36th day after the ablactation; feeding the piglets with fourth fodder from the 37th day after ablactation of the piglets to the 61st day after ablactation; feeding the piglets with fifth fodder from the 62nd day after ablactation of the piglets to the 88th day after ablactation; feeding the piglets with sixth fodder from the 89th day after ablactation of the piglets to the 145th day after ablactation; feeding the piglets with seventh fodder from the 146th day after ablactation of the piglets to the 170th day after ablactation. Compared with the prior art, the integrated high-efficiency low-cost breeding method disclosed by the invention fully considers the growth and development and the nutrition characteristics of the sows and the piglets in different stages, the nutrition is scientific and balanced, promotion and application are convenient, the comprehensive economic cost is low, and a very good market application prospect is obtained.
